Spurs secured a massive win against Arsenal in Thursday’s north London derby. However, they need victories against Burnley and Norwich to keep their hopes of Champions League football alive.
Burnley have enjoyed something of a revival under caretaker boss Mike Jackson, but are still fighting to stay in the Premier League. They go into the weekend just one place outside the drop zone.
Cristian Romero has been an essential component for Antonio Conte’s side but will miss the final games of the season due to injury. Ashley Westwood, Matej Vydra, Ben Mee, James Tarkowski and Jay Rodriguez are all missing for Burnley.
Here’s how they line up:
Tottenham: Lloris, Sanchez, Dier, Davies, Emerson, Bentancur, Hojbjerg, Sessegnon, Moura, Son, Kane
Burnley: Pope, Roberts, Collins, Long, Taylor, McNeil, Cork, Brownhill, Lowton, Cornet, Barnes
Burnley won the reverse fixture 1-0 earlier this season thanks to a determined display. Spurs came into that game on the back of their dramatic 2-3 win over Manchester City and put in a poor performance. They cannot afford to make the same mistake again.
